From my reading of the rules, it sounds like you have to use drop pods if you take them, while teleporting is optional;

"any ... terminator squad ... may be equiped with a drop pod. (snip) Such units remain in reserve and arrive by drop pod."  (P. 21)

It doesn't mention anything about having the option of deploying normally, although the rules for teleporting clearly uses the phrase "may start in reserve."

Since there are clearly some circumstances where you would want terminators to deploy normally (e.g. playing against nids/orks) this suggests drop pods may actually have a slight drawback, and not be such a no-brainer after all.

Another related query is that the Lysander "Teleport Assault" rule says;

"If an Imperial Fist army including Lysander elects to deploy its Terminators by Deep Strike..."

As the drop pod rules do not specifically state they deep strike, its seems you have to teleport in to use this special rule, which in turn prevents a Lysander wing using drop pods if they want to arrive together.

If I'm interpreting these correctly, it seems that the Lysander wing isn't such a no-brainer, and there may actually be a tactical reason to paint a terminator-heavy army something other than yellow!
